WHAT HAPPENED

Chelsea have formally informed Manchester City that winger Pedro Neto is valued at £70 million ahead of the summer transfer window. The 26-year-old forward has emerged as a primary attacking target for City following a productive individual campaign in which he registered five goals and six assists during a challenging Premier League season for Chelsea. Neto was recently spotted boarding a flight to Hong Kong to join up with manager Xabi Alonso's squad for upcoming fixtures, even as speculation surrounding his long-term future in west London intensifies.

BACKGROUND AND CONTEXT

Neto originally joined Chelsea in 2024 for a transfer fee valued at approximately £51 million. During his time at Stamford Bridge, he has added significant silverware to his resume, contributing to the club's successful campaigns in both the UEFA Europa Conference League and the FIFA Club World Cup. His performances have caught the eye of rival scouts looking to bolster their attacking options.

IMPACT ANALYSIS

If Manchester City meets the £70 million valuation, Chelsea stands to secure a substantial profit of roughly £19 million on a player signed just a year prior. For City, adding Neto would provide further depth and tactical flexibility in their frontline, though the hefty fee underscores the premium placed on proven Premier League performers.
